Commit Graph

278 Commits

Author SHA1 Message Date
yves b9a1233e0e uuid return on create ne message
continuous-integration/drone/push Build is failing
2026-04-18 21:46:28 +02:00
yves a5dd6cd73f delete peer cache fix
continuous-integration/drone/push Build is failing
2026-04-18 20:40:23 +02:00
yves 00e4e6b046 cleaner invitation step messages 2026-04-14 19:12:09 +02:00
yves 327bd390c4 fixes step 2
continuous-integration/drone/push Build is failing
2026-04-12 13:38:15 +02:00
yves 793213b3fb refactor invitation 2026-04-11 22:05:30 +02:00
ycc 1906431061 invitation process upgrade
continuous-integration/drone/push Build is failing
2026-04-02 20:26:35 +02:00
ycc 9f130a80b7 sequences update and async crypto keys optimization
continuous-integration/drone/push Build is failing
2026-03-31 21:32:46 +02:00
ycc d23ab73cf9 message ack receice and reactions protobuf
continuous-integration/drone/push Build is failing
2026-03-06 11:59:47 +01:00
ycc f6531e344e MarkMessageProcessed added
continuous-integration/drone/push Build is failing
2026-03-05 21:33:03 +01:00
ycc 32cc9ff848 double ratchet key persitence bugfix
continuous-integration/drone/push Build is failing
2026-03-05 09:06:16 +01:00
ycc f4fb42d72e double ratchet first implementation
continuous-integration/drone/push Build is failing
2026-03-04 22:30:22 +01:00
ycc c0dcfe997c Adding inner symetric encryption
continuous-integration/drone/push Build is failing
2026-03-04 21:40:26 +01:00
ycc 5748ead926 received timestamp added to bd
continuous-integration/drone/push Build is failing
2026-03-04 11:58:14 +01:00
ycc 14a07dcb5c delivery ack added
continuous-integration/drone/push Build is failing
2026-03-04 10:44:17 +01:00
ycc fab5818ec7 adding peer/contactcard attributes
continuous-integration/drone/push Build is failing
2026-03-03 10:46:25 +01:00
ycc 8836d5c591 fix add srvr key fetch from bg send
continuous-integration/drone/push Build is failing
2026-03-01 22:50:54 +01:00
ycc 0fdf5dd9c7 simplify send message bg helper
continuous-integration/drone/push Build is failing
2026-03-01 21:15:17 +01:00
ycc 7d06f0ff3e timeout fix
continuous-integration/drone/push Build is failing
2026-03-01 14:23:07 +01:00
ycc b722a916a9 change impl of last fix
continuous-integration/drone/push Build is failing
2026-02-28 21:22:15 +01:00
ycc cd9ee54f6d jobs ack fix
continuous-integration/drone/push Build is failing
2026-02-28 21:04:13 +01:00
ycc 67823237e6 remove useless password
continuous-integration/drone/push Build is failing
2026-02-28 19:01:49 +01:00
ycc aa91d2cc0f adding message sent date
continuous-integration/drone/push Build is failing
2026-02-28 18:35:27 +01:00
ycc 66a6674a6a ProcessSentMessages added for server acks
continuous-integration/drone/push Build is failing
2026-02-28 10:08:55 +01:00
ycc a322f3fccf add fields for server delivery tracking
continuous-integration/drone/push Build is failing
2026-02-27 21:45:44 +01:00
ycc e6f9bc796e count sends
continuous-integration/drone/push Build is failing
2026-02-27 20:58:15 +01:00
ycc f76213d55a nil pointer fix
continuous-integration/drone/push Build is failing
2026-02-27 20:13:58 +01:00
ycc aeeebf6f58 add missing server encryption
continuous-integration/drone/push Build is failing
2026-02-26 22:08:45 +01:00
ycc 423c5d6d64 refactor to separate uder packing from server packing
continuous-integration/drone/push Build is failing
2026-02-26 21:07:38 +01:00
ycc eb7fdc9b03 bg sender first draft
continuous-integration/drone/push Build is failing
2026-02-26 18:50:46 +01:00
ycc cfa20861c5 reduce storage functions scope 2026-02-25 22:05:58 +01:00
ycc e9cc5b9c76 typo
continuous-integration/drone/push Build is failing
2026-02-25 20:36:21 +01:00
ycc e6aa919b74 Functions renaming
continuous-integration/drone/push Build is failing
2026-02-25 20:24:04 +01:00
ycc c784f6f315 loki disable if non valid url
continuous-integration/drone/push Build is failing
2026-02-09 19:06:47 +01:00
ycc cd24da25d2 lokiwriter safer log server management
continuous-integration/drone/push Build is failing
2026-02-08 21:18:31 +01:00
ycc cd0864bd9a add router tests 2026-02-04 20:37:07 +01:00
ycc e3c100df94 adding server test 2026-02-04 20:04:19 +01:00
ycc 4fe989b5ff adding basic peer tests 2026-02-04 19:42:28 +01:00
ycc b1ecd04a28 better error management + shortcode overflow control 2026-02-04 18:28:14 +01:00
ycc bb3640c1c3 serverlist testing and bugfixes 2026-02-02 19:22:49 +01:00
ycc 9e0751e0d0 remove some fatal vioelent exits 2026-02-02 18:58:08 +01:00
ycc 353ef42752 pw protected invitation get destroyed after 3 failed retrieval attempts 2026-02-02 18:53:39 +01:00
ycc 63a916d18a Also encrypt additional passwords in memory 2026-02-02 18:28:24 +01:00
ycc 7cf212fc76 Main password encrypted in memory 2026-02-02 18:15:57 +01:00
ycc bb56b8dd9c fix randomizer and err in config 2026-02-02 15:32:36 +01:00
ycc f498cfad1e keypair err mgt + shorturl random improve 2026-02-02 15:11:41 +01:00
ycc f8537aad6d long poll exit fix 2025-05-07 22:53:34 +02:00
ycc 8d589505e5 change array of pointer to array of requestjobs 2025-05-07 20:44:41 +02:00
ycc 511e260157 change longpoll job array param type 2025-05-04 23:19:18 +02:00
ycc 839fb7c0f9 long poll helper first draft - untested 2025-05-04 22:34:20 +02:00
ycc 3af112b860 go 1.24 2025-05-04 21:12:55 +02:00